Output 905404a2e7c6ae76626479a380e82bf30a183fcbe185777ec42c07d2e4397cd4:4

value
1648700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8759566fb7a2139e4eac1539c2077bf4a92ba4d9 OP_EQUAL
address
3E2gAjEovpP8x72Gp6WKb98KuCN7GBB1yi
transaction
905404a2e7c6ae76626479a380e82bf30a183fcbe185777ec42c07d2e4397cd4
spent
true